Astro Turf Maintenance: Keeping Your Artificial Grass Looking Lush and Green

Introduction to Astro Turf Maintenance

Astro turf, also known as artificial grass, has become a popular choice for homeowners, businesses, and sports facilities alike. Its durability, low maintenance requirements, and realistic appearance make it an attractive option. However, to keep your astro turf looking lush and green, proper maintenance is essential. In this article, we'll explore the key steps and best practices for astro turf maintenance, ensuring your investment stays in top condition.

Understanding Astro Turf: What It Is and How It Works

Before diving into maintenance, it's important to understand what astro turf is and how it works. Astro turf is a synthetic grass product designed to mimic the look and feel of natural grass. It consists of a woven or tufted synthetic fiber base, topped with a layer of infill material, typically rubber or sand, to provide cushioning and stability.

Key Maintenance Steps for Astro Turf

1. Regular Cleaning

Regular cleaning is crucial for maintaining the appearance and longevity of your astro turf. Here's how to do it:

a. Brushing

Use a stiff-bristled brush to remove debris, leaves, and dirt from the surface. Brush in the direction of the grass blades for the best results.

b. Raking

Gently rake the astro turf to remove any debris that may have settled between the blades.

c. Hose-Off

Occasionally, use a garden hose to rinse the astro turf, removing any stubborn dirt or stains. Be sure to use a gentle stream of water to avoid damaging the fibers.

2. Deep Cleaning

Deep cleaning is necessary to remove embedded dirt and debris that regular cleaning can't reach. Here's how to do it:

a. Renting a Pressure Washer

Rent a pressure washer with a low-pressure setting to avoid damaging the astro turf fibers. Use a wide-angle nozzle to clean the surface thoroughly.

b. Cleaning Solutions

For tough stains, consider using a mild detergent or a specialized astro turf cleaner. Be sure to follow the manufacturer's instructions for proper use.

3. Infill Management

Infill material plays a crucial role in the performance and appearance of your astro turf. Here's how to manage it:

a. Replenishing Infill

Over time, infill material can become compacted or washed away. Replenish the infill as needed to maintain the desired thickness and performance.

b. Preventing Infill Loss

Regularly check for signs of infill loss, such as bare patches or visible sand. Use infill netting or other protective measures to prevent further loss.

4. Edging and Sealing

Edging and sealing are important for maintaining the appearance and longevity of your astro turf:

a. Edging

Use a landscape edging tool to trim the astro turf along the edges of your installation. This helps prevent the grass from spreading into unwanted areas.

b. Sealing

Apply a sealant to protect the astro turf from UV rays, stains, and wear. Follow the manufacturer's instructions for proper application.

5. Regular Inspections

Regular inspections are essential for identifying and addressing any potential issues before they become major problems. Here's what to look for:

a. Wear and Tear

Check for signs of wear and tear, such as frayed fibers or bare patches. Address these issues promptly to prevent further damage.

b. Infill Level

Ensure that the infill level is consistent throughout the astro turf installation. Low infill levels can lead to poor performance and appearance.
